WebMar 4, 2024 · Wear a pair of pants you already own and measure the inseam length. If needed, adjust the cuff to the desired length. With no or little break, the pant leg should lay comfortably on the bottom of your shoes. Take off the pants and measure the flipped cuff’s length. Subtract that amount from the length of the pants. WebJun 7, 2024 · There are five popular pants breaks in the world of fashion. 1. Full break: A full break leaves the most length in a pair of pant legs and allows for a small amount of fabric bunching at the top of the shoe. A full break works best with a baggy pair of pleated dress trousers with a wide leg opening. This style was considered dapper in the mid ...
